Men took $200 from shop

Christchurch detectives -ret seeking two men who robbed, the Pointe Ballet Shop in Victoria Street of $2OO in cash yesterday, and a man who indecently assaulted a girl. The thieves walked into: the shop about 10.23 a m. and: helped themselves to the till/ When the proprietor came out and tried to stop them he was grabbed and pushed: over behind the counter. The men. who were not armed, took $2OO in $lO notes from the till and ran to al; waiting car. Detectives and uniformed' policemen were on the scene/ in less than a minute, but a extensive search of the ■ area revealed no trace of the thieves. ; The proprietor of the shop was not injured. I One of the men was

! described as a Maori or 'Samoan, aged between 20! and 23, about 1.54 m, of) medium build, with an Afro; hairstyle. No description ofj the other man was available last evening. The indecent assault on a seven-year-old girl took place; in the public toilets at' Abberlev Park, St Albans.; last Friday. The girl, who had been) playing in the park, was! approached and indecently! !i,ssaulted about 6.25 p.m.. a! [C.1.8. spokesman said. She' screamed for help, and her! attacker ran off. The man the police are seeking is described as a European, aged between 19 < and 24. of slim build, with! 'fuzzy, shoulder-length ginger! hair. He was wearing a blue! jacket and blue trousers.
